.” States award this certification when counties achieve established goals of individuals in the workforce earning the ACT National Career Readiness Certificate (NCRCTM) and businesses recognizing, preferring, or recommending the NCRC. States may add additional criteria to their specific initiatives.

The Arkansas Economic Development Commission (AEDC), working with other state agencies, offers a Career Readiness Certificate to potential employees. Through the Career Readiness Certificate program, potential employees are evaluated and tested so that your business can identify and qualify the most skilled workers.

Kansas is a right-to-work state, bringing one additional cost saving to employers. In addition to a strong work ethic, Kansas workers are highly educated. The state ranks 17th in the nation for percentage of adults, 25 and over, with a high school education, and 16th for percentage of adults with a college degree.
